Kingdom Hearts II: Final Mix + Secrets and Unlockables (PS2)

SHARE:

Adjust text size:



Enlarge picture
In September 2006, Square Enix announced they would develop Kingdom Hearts II Final Mix+, featuring new scenes and gameplay elements. Kingdom Hearts II Final Mix+ is a 2-disc set. The first disc contains Kingdom Hearts II Final Mix, which added content including extra cutscenes and optional bosses to Kingdom Hearts II. The second disc contains Kingdom Hearts Re: Chain of Memories, a 3D PS2 version remake of Kingdom Hearts: Chain of Memories with Kingdom Hearts II and Kingdom Hearts' graphics, extra scenes, and voiceover for particular scenes. The battle system continues the card gameplay, with the addition of using Reaction Commands. The game was released in Japan on March 29, 2007. Several independent sources state that a release in North America will occur in fall 2007 with no confirmation from Square Enix.

Unlockables

New Modes
Reverse/Rebirth mode - Complete the game once

Theater mode - Complete the game once

Secrets

Faster Unlimited Heartless Battles Without Map Cards
If you do not wish to (or cannot) use False Bounty, then try this. Warp to the entrance room of a world from a different floor, and there will be Heartless there. Defeat them, then warp to a different floor. You may repeat this as many times as desired without using a single Map Card.

Heartless battles without Map Cards.
In order to have unlimited battles with Heartless without wasting your Map Cards simply save your game. Then use a False Bounty and open the 2 chests that contain Heartless but always leave the one with the treasure close. Once you've fought the 2 Heartless chests, get out of the room and re-enter, both Heartless chests will be close again for you to fight them again.

Repeat
this process as many times as you want to level up without using any extra Map Cards.

Unlockable cards
Complete the task in order to get the card.

Ansem Card in Sora's Story - Beat Reverse Rebirth and find it in a chest in Castle Oblivion

Bambi Summon Card - Lead Pooh to the end of 100 Acre Wood

Blazing Donald Skill - Open Key of Rewards Door in Agrabah

Blizzrad Raid - Use Calm Bounty in Olympus Colleseum

Captain Hook Card - Beat Captain Hook

Cloud summon card - Defeat Hades

Darkside Card - Beat Darkside

Diamond Dust - Beat the game with Sora once. Then load your game and use a Calm Bounty in Castle Oblivion.(You do not have to beat Reverse/Rebirth)

Dragon Maleficent Card - Beat Maleficent

Dumbo summon card - Finish "Monstro" level

Elixir card - In 100 hundred acre wood lead pooh in to the hole with tracks leading into it.

Firaga Break - Use Calm Bounty in Twilight Town

Fire Raid - Use Calm Bounty in Halloween Town

Genie Summon Card - Defeat Jafar

Gifted Miracle - Use Calm Bounty in Halloween Town

Gravity - Use Calm Bounty in Agrabah

Gravity Raid Skill - Open Key of Rewards Door in Halloween Town

Hades Card - Beat Hades

Summons
Where to get each summon:

Chicken Little - In the 100 Acre Wood, after the world's second cutscene.

Genie - Defeat Volcano Lord and Blizzard Lord

Peter Pan - In the ship graveyard in the second visit to Port Royal.

Stitch - In the hallway to the computer room in Hollow Bastion, after you get Master Form.

Unlockables 2

How to Unlock the Fight against the ES/AU
To be able to go against this secret boss, first you must have completed the game, which means you must defeat the end boss, Xemnas. Since now you can save after defeating the game's end boss. The other objective would be to defeat the 5 Organization XIII members in their "Absent Silhouette" battles. Their battles can be accessed in different parts of the game worlds. After both of those are done, a portal will be open in Disney Castle "Hall of the CornerStone". The portal leads to the secret boss.

Organization Xll Battles - Absent Silhouette
Fight the Five Defeated Organization XIII members that were not seen in the original story:

Larxene Port Royal - Isla de la Muerte

Lexaeus Twilight Town(2nd Time) - The Sandlot

Marluxia Beast's Castle(2nd Time) - Beast's Room

Vexen Agrabah(2nd Time) - Merchant's Shop

Zexion Underworld - Cave of the Dead

Theater Mode
Theater Mode allows the viewer to view the cutscenes from the games. Kingdom Hearts II: Final Mix allows the viewer to watch them in English and Japanese. To unlock Theater Mode, one must have completed both Kingdom Hearts II: Final Mix and Kingdom Hearts Re:Chain of Memories on a memory card, to unlock Theater Mode in both games.

Theater Mode in Kingdom Hearts II: Final Mix Complete Kingdom Hearts Re:Chain of Memories and Kingdom Hearts II: Final Mix

Theater Mode in Kingdom Hearts Re:Chain of Memories Complete Kingdom Hearts Re:Chain of Memories and Kingdom Hearts II: Final Mix

Unlock new secret ending
Beginner Mode - Cannot be unlocked on this mode

Critical Mode - Complete all worlds

Proud Mode - Beat all new org battles, Complete all worlds, Beat E.S (Knight boss)

Standard Mode - Beat all new org battles , Complete all worlds, Complete Jiminy's journal (need Mickey sign next to it), Beat E.S (Knight boss)
